Casino Game Accessibility And User-Friendly Design

Clear navigation is one of the most important accessibility features. Players should be able to locate game categories, account information, betting controls, rules, and settings without navigating through unnecessarily complicated menus. A simple structure can make the overall experience easier to understand.

Text presentation also matters. Game instructions, payout tables, and betting information should be readable on different screen sizes. Adequate text size and clear spacing can help players identify important information, particularly when using smartphones or tablets.

Casino interfaces often rely heavily on visual indicators. Symbols, animations, buttons, and status messages communicate information about bets, wins, and bonus features. Good design can combine visual signals with other forms of feedback so that important information is not dependent on a single presentation method.

Audio controls can provide additional flexibility. Players may be able to adjust game volume, mute background music, or disable certain sound effects. This allows individuals to customize the experience according to their environment and personal preferences.

Touchscreen compatibility is particularly important for mobile casino games. Buttons need to be appropriately sized and positioned so that players can select them accurately. Important actions should also be clearly separated to reduce the possibility of accidental selections.

Responsive design helps casino games function across different devices. A game designed for desktop computers may need to reorganize its interface when displayed on a smartphone. Responsive layouts can adjust reels, betting controls, menus, and information panels to accommodate different screen dimensions.

Some games provide adjustable settings that allow players to personalize the interface. These may include sound controls, animation settings, display options, or other preferences. Customization can make the experience more comfortable and easier to navigate.

Accessibility is also relevant to game instructions. Casino games can contain numerous features, including wild symbols, bonus rounds, multipliers, jackpots, and special betting conditions. Clearly organized help sections can explain these mechanics without requiring players to search through unrelated information.

Consistent interface design can further improve usability. When similar buttons and menus behave in predictable ways across different games, players can become familiar with the platform more quickly. Consistency is particularly useful for people who regularly switch between casino titles.

Accessibility should not be confused with game fairness or profitability. A game can have an excellent interface while still operating with a mathematical house advantage. User-friendly design improves navigation and understanding, but it does not change probabilities, RTP, or payout structures.

Players should also remain aware of responsible gambling considerations. Convenient interfaces can make it very easy to move between games and start new rounds. Features such as clear balance displays and accessible account controls can help players monitor their activity more effectively.

Online casinos and game developers may follow different technical standards and design practices, so accessibility can vary considerably between platforms. Players who require particular interface features should review the available settings and compatibility information before choosing a platform.

Overall, accessible casino game design combines clear navigation, readable information, responsive layouts, practical controls, and customizable audio or display features. These elements can make digital casino games easier to use while preserving the underlying rules and mathematical structure of the games.
